The Importance Of Clinical Incinerators In Healthcare Facilities

In healthcare facilities, proper waste management is crucial to ensure the safety of patients, staff, and the environment. Clinical waste, also known as medical waste, can pose serious health risks if not handled and disposed of properly. This is where clinical incinerators play a vital role.

A clinical incinerator is a type of furnace that is specifically designed to safely and efficiently dispose of medical waste through high-temperature burning. This process is known as incineration and is one of the most effective methods for destroying pathogens and reducing the volume of waste. clinical incinerators are equipped with advanced features to control and monitor the temperature, gas flow, and emissions during the incineration process.

One of the key benefits of using a clinical incinerator is the ability to eliminate potentially infectious materials, such as used needles, contaminated dressings, and cultures, in a manner that minimizes the risk of exposure to harmful microorganisms. By subjecting the waste to high temperatures of up to 1,100 degrees Celsius, clinical incinerators can effectively kill bacteria, viruses, and other pathogens present in the waste stream.

Furthermore, clinical incinerators are designed to reduce the volume of waste by up to 90%, thereby minimizing the amount of waste that needs to be transported and disposed of in landfills. This not only saves space but also reduces the carbon footprint associated with waste transportation and disposal.

In addition to their role in managing infectious waste, clinical incinerators can also be used to safely dispose of pharmaceutical waste, chemotherapy waste, and other hazardous materials that require special handling. By using a clinical incinerator, healthcare facilities can ensure compliance with environmental regulations and prevent the release of harmful substances into the air, soil, or water.

Moreover, clinical incinerators are equipped with pollution control devices, such as scrubbers, filters, and monitoring systems, to ensure that the emissions generated during the incineration process meet the strictest environmental standards. These devices help to trap and neutralize harmful gases, particulates, and volatile organic compounds before they are released into the atmosphere.

When choosing a clinical incinerator for a healthcare facility, it is important to consider factors such as capacity, efficiency, emissions, and compliance with regulatory requirements. Modern incinerators are available in a range of sizes and configurations to accommodate the specific waste management needs of different facilities.

It is also crucial to provide proper training to staff members who will be operating the clinical incinerator to ensure safe and effective operation. Training should cover topics such as waste segregation, loading procedures, temperature control, emission monitoring, and emergency response protocols.
